What is a Home Equity Loan?
A home equity loan, also known as a second mortgage, is a loan that allows homeowners to borrow against the equity in their property. Equity is the difference between the market value of your home and the amount you still owe on your mortgage. For example, if your home is worth $300,000 and you owe $200,000 on your mortgage, you have $100,000 in equity.
How Does the Home Equity Loan Process Work?
The home equity loan process in Moody typically involves the following steps:
1. Determine Your Equity: The first step is to determine how much equity you have in your home. This can be done by getting a current appraisal of your property and subtracting the amount you owe on your mortgage.
2. Shop Around: Once you know how much equity you have, it’s time to shop around for lenders. Compare interest rates, terms, and fees from multiple lenders to find the best deal for your needs.
3. Submit an Application: After choosing a lender, you’ll need to submit an application for a home equity loan. You’ll need to provide information about your income, assets, and debts, as well as details about your property.
4. Get Approved: The lender will review your application and determine whether you qualify for a home equity loan. If approved, you’ll receive a loan offer outlining the terms and conditions of the loan.
5. Close the Loan: If you accept the loan offer, you’ll need to go through the closing process. This typically involves signing legal documents, paying closing costs, and receiving the funds from the loan.
6. Repay the Loan: Once you have the funds from your home equity loan, you’ll need to make regular monthly payments to repay the loan. These payments will include both principal and interest.
Benefits of a Home Equity Loan
There are several benefits to taking out a home equity loan in Moody:
1. Lower Interest Rates: Home equity loans typically have lower interest rates compared to other types of loans, making them a cost-effective borrowing option.
2. Tax Deductible: In some cases, the interest paid on a home equity loan may be tax-deductible, providing potential savings for homeowners.
3. Access to Funds: Home equity loans provide homeowners with access to a large sum of money that can be used for a variety of purposes.
